ILX LIGHTWAVE'S UNIVERSITY DONATION PROGRAM
State-of-the-art equipment is necessary to keep any program on the cutting edge. Thats why ILX Lightwave
started the University Donation Program. We want to help colleges and universities create quality programs where
the next generation of scientists and engineers can remain at the forefront of photonic research and development.
Through the donation of $20,000 of laser diode test and measurement equipment annually, ILX Lightwave is helping
arm the nations colleges and universities with the state-of-the-art laser diode technology they need to keep their photonics
programs on the cutting edge.
Who Can Apply
Any accredited US college or university is eligible to apply for the $10,000 equipment award. We make a conscious attempt to balance requests from both large and small colleges, as well as look for opportunities to build programs and working partnerships with colleges throughout the country.
When to Apply
Up to two awards of $10,000 in ILX equipment will be presented in the month January. Award applications must be received by ILX before August 31, 2009.
How to Apply
Applications for ILX Lightwaves University Donation Program should include the following materials:
- Proposal Cover Letter
This must be completed and signed by the Principal Investigator or Program Coordinator and attached to the proposal.
- Technical Proposal
The proposal should be no more than two pages in length and include the following information:
- Executive Summary
A short summary statement should outline the objective(s) of the research or application of the equipment and how ILX instrumentation will address those needs.
- Abstract
An abstract of the proposed research or application of the instrumentation should include goals, objectives, and methodology to be used.
- Schedule
A schedule should cover the proposed starting and ending dates and when the awarded instrumentation is required.
- Equipment Needs
A list of specified instrumentation, manufactured only by ILX Lightwave, need to accomplish the proposed goals. Products released within the last year are not available for donation.
Note: ILX Lightwave does not manufacture laser diodes.
- Background Information
Include any background information or brochures that support the scope and quality of the university's photonics-related programs.
Judging Criteria
Recipients are chosen based on the quality of the university's photonics educational program and the relevance of the proposed research to the future of laser diode technology and applications.
